Frequently Asked Questions

What are the closest trade schools to Felt, Oklahoma, and how far away are they?

The closest trade schools to Felt are High Plains Technology Center in Guymon (about 30 miles west) and Western Technology Center in Sayre (about 45 miles southeast). Both are within reasonable commuting distance and offer programs relevant to the local economy, such as welding, HVAC, and automotive technology.

Which trade programs in the Felt, OK area have the strongest local job placement rates?

Programs with strong local job placement near Felt include Welding Technology and HVAC/R at High Plains Technology Center, and Electrical Trades at Western Technology Center. These fields align with needs in regional agriculture, energy, and construction industries, leading to good employment opportunities in the Oklahoma Panhandle.

Are there any short-term certification programs available near Felt for someone looking to enter the workforce quickly?

Yes, both High Plains Technology Center and Western Technology Center offer short-term certifications. For example, you can complete basic welding certifications or HVAC technician programs in less than a year. These accelerated programs are designed to help residents of Felt and surrounding areas gain employable skills for local trade jobs efficiently.

What financial aid or tuition assistance options are available for Felt residents attending trade schools in the area?

Felt residents can access federal financial aid (FAFSA), Oklahoma's CareerTech scholarships, and local workforce development grants through High Plains and Western Technology Centers. Many programs also offer payment plans, and some employers in the region provide tuition reimbursement for in-demand trades like electrical systems and automotive service.

How do the trade programs near Felt, Oklahoma, connect students with local apprenticeships or on-the-job training?

Both technology centers near Felt have established partnerships with regional employers for apprenticeships and clinical rotations. For instance, welding students often get placed with local fabrication shops or energy companies, while HVAC students train with area contractors. These connections provide practical experience and often lead directly to job offers in the Oklahoma Panhandle.
